  • Patent number: 11975100
    Abstract: A process for preparing and isolating pharmaceutical active ingredient particles having a particle size of between about 0.1 and 30 microns, wherein a slurry comprising the active ingredient and one or more pharmaceutically acceptable excipients is fed into a thin film evaporator under suitable conditions for less than 10 minutes sufficient to generate solid matrix particles comprising active ingredient and one or more excipients, wherein the particles have less than 5% residual solvent.

  • Patent number: 11494530
    Abstract: One example includes a method for generating a solar farm design. Geographic map data defines geographic features and boundaries of a geographic region. A solar panel block library that stores virtual solar panel block types is accessed. Each of the virtual solar panel block types corresponds to a design of a respective solar panel block that includes solar panels, an inverter, and an access road, and each virtual solar panel block type includes predetermined dimensions and a predefined output power rating. An array of a virtual solar panel block type to fit within the geographic features and boundaries of the geographic region on the map is generated based on the dimensions of each of the virtual solar panel blocks in the array. The array is iteratively modified to optimize a criterion of the solar farm design, and the design is stored in a memory for subsequent solar farm installation.
